We went on a mini little road trip to Anaheim and found ourselves close to the Anaheim Packing House. We had decided to grab lunch at Cultivation Kitchen so we stopped there first.
Cultivation Kitchen is a really beautiful, earthy space that’s filled with light and greenery. We ordered, took our number, and got seated.
Hubby had ordered a mix-n-match healthy plate with organic chicken, roasted cauliflower, and roasted broccoli. His dish was a plate of heavenly flavors. If we ever get the chance to come back I will definitely be doing a healthy plate!
I ordered the SLT grilled grass fed beef, avocado, arugula, caramelized red onions, roasted tomatoes and red peppers with smoked tomato-jalapeno jam. The sandwich was very good, but a little on the greasy end. The salad served on the side was bright and fresh and delicious.
I think this is a good spot if you’re looking for some whole, yummy tasting food. Of course, you guys know I need something sweet and much to my luck there was a Honey & Butter trailer right outside the restaurant.
This place has some of the best macarons I’ve had. Their buttercream filling is so yummy! I got a fruity pebbles and a milk and honey flavored one. They were both so good, but my favorite was the fruity pebbles.
After our lunch we walked around the Packing House and took in some music. We hung out until it was time for us to meet a friend for some tea and walking around. It’s always a fun foodie adventure coming to/near the Packing House.
